Strength in Numbers

The Cooper Foundation established the COVID-19 Assistance Fund to support our health care professionals on the front lines caring for patients during this pandemic.

Since the fund started on March 24, 2020, we have received more than 50,000 donated masks, eye shields, gloves, and face shields (N95, surgical, 3D printed, and fabric), and more than 6,000 meals delivered to Cooper staff, thanks to compassionate supporters who understand that food can give comfort.

In addition to significant in-kind donations, The Cooper Foundation has received more than 350 contributions from individuals and businesses in the community.

Donations have come online, in the mail, through Go Fund Me, Facebook, birthday parties, restaurants, businesses, community groups, a law firm organizing its colleagues, a 9-year-old’s savings account, schools, patients, and families. Our community has embraced our needs with overwhelming generosity.
